About The Position

At Numero, we build software for political campaigns and nonprofits. Since our founding in 2019, we’ve scaled our platform to serve thousands of clients ranging from city council seats to US Senate races, and have helped them collectively manage over $10B in contributions. Our platform is an all-in-one system comprised of a donor CRM, a broadcast email/text tool, and payment processing pages that our clients rely on for their work every day. With rapid growth over the past 18 months, we're hiring our first dedicated Accounts Receivable Specialist to join our finance team and help us scale our billing operations. This is a foundational role—you'll own the AR function from day one, working closely with our Financial Controller to ensure smooth billing operations and healthy cash flow. Responsibilities

  • Monitor and manage all accounts receivable activity across our client base.
  • Follow up promptly on open invoices and past-due accounts via email.
  • Process disputed contributions from our payment processing pages.
  • Ensure timely cash collection in line with net 10-day payment terms.
  • Maintain accurate AR aging reports and track collection metrics.
  • Identify and escalate collection issues as needed.
  • Respond to internal and external client questions about invoices, payments, and account status.
  • Build positive relationships with clients while maintaining professional boundaries around payment expectations.
  • Coordinate with the sales and customer success teams to resolve billing-related client issues.
  • Handle billing disputes with empathy and professionalism.
  • Assist with contract management and ensure billing aligns with contract terms.
  • Help prepare monthly client billing reports and revenue summaries.
  • Support month-end close activities related to revenue and receivables.
  • Contribute to process improvements as we scale our billing operations from hundreds to thousands of clients.
  • Assist with QuickBooks entries and reconciliations as needed.
  • Record vendor invoices.
  • Help maintain organized financial records and documentation.
  • Support ad hoc finance and operations projects.
  • Collaborate with our Financial Controller on building out financial processes and systems (including expanding the use of AI in our team).
